The Argentine’s father revealed his desire to see the star again in the Catalan jersey, but the Argentine press says that his son has other plans for the future.
With a contract in Paris until 2023, there are those who want to see ‘La Pulga’ again at Camp Nou but, according to Argentine channel Direct TV, Lionel Messi’s immediate plans do not end there.
The source advances that Messi plans to spend the next season at PSG while agreeing to buy 35% of Inter Miami, a club owned by David Beckham in the MLS, where he would join in the summer of 2023, at zero cost.
In this way, the 34-year-old Argentinian intends to ensure that he still competes at a high enough level to be able to be at full strength in the 2022 World Cup, at the same time fulfilling the desire to head to the United States in the final phase of his career, which he has already expressed in past.
Lionel Messi completed an underwhelming debut season at PSG after leaving Barcelona last summer. In terms of numbers, he scored 11 goals and 13 assists in 33 games played.
